    Brake Fluids

    I flushed my brake system after 2 years. My bike spends most of the day parked outside at work. While most brake systems are weather proof, some moisture will make its way into the fluid. Since brake fluid is hygroscopic, it absorbs and holds water, changing it on a regular basis is a good...

    Setting the idle low

    There are many reasons companies specify a specific idle speed. Oil pressure, coolant flow, manifold vacuum, etc. Setting it to 1000 rpm is not likely going to cause any harm. Yamaha may have decided the 1250-1350 range is the minimum to get decent intake air swirl to get complete combustion...
